最近在做MATLAB仿真,经常遇到信道仿真,常见的两个就是AWGN信道和瑞利衰落信道,做一般的ofdm仿真时会让信号依次经过这两个信道模型产生接收信号。
下面简单聊几句关于这两个信道模型,关于具体说明,大家直接在MATLAB命令窗口输入:
help awgn 和help rayleighchan就行,官方文档解释得更详细。
另外推荐一本初学者学习通信MATLAB仿真的书:详解MATLAB/simulink 通信系统建模与仿真 刘学勇编著,这本书还有配套视频,特别适合初学者。
AWGN信道
加性高斯白噪声是最常见的一种噪声,awgn的均值为0,方差为噪声功率的大小。
MATLAB提供的函数为awgn函数,常用形式为:
y=awgn(x, snr)
其中x为发送信号,y为接收信号,snr为信噪比。
瑞利衰落信道
瑞利衰落又称多径衰落,通过瑞利信道的信号需要进行补偿,不然误码率会很大,即利用导频进行估计。
MATLAB提供的函数是rayleighchan函数和filter函数,常见用法:
chan=rayleighchan(t, f) ;
y=filter(chan, x);
第一个函数是生成瑞利信道,t为采样时间,f为最大多普勒频移。第二个函数是让信号x通过瑞利信道,y是接收信号。
最后
以上就是正直钢笔最近收集整理的关于常见通信信道仿真模型AWGN信道瑞利衰落信道的全部内容,更多相关常见通信信道仿真模型AWGN信道瑞利衰落信道内容请搜索靠谱客的其他文章。
本图文内容来源于网友提供,作为学习参考使用,或来自网络收集整理,版权属于原作者所有。
发表评论 取消回复